
 
	
	#header #logo {
		display: block;
		text-align: center; 
	}
	
	#header nav, .tx-srlanguagemenu, #dropnav, #c105 h1 {
	  display: none;
	}
	
	#footer .col-md-1 {
		display: none;
	}
	
	#body {
		padding-top: 0px !important;
	}
	
	.csc-textpic-right {
		float: none;
		display: block;
	} 
	
	.csc-textpic-below {
		float: none;
		display: block;
	}
	
	div.csc-textpic-right .csc-textpic-imagewrap {
    	float: none;
	}
	
	#homelogos img {
		max-width: 150px;
	}
	
	.news-single-img img {
		max-width: 300px !important;
		height: auto !important;
	}
